W. H. Freeman, 2000. 1st U.S. . Hardcover. As New/As New. Sturdy book, blue cloth spine, green boards, very bright gilt lettering on spine, 271 pages with a few illustrations. DJ glossy light green background, a blue triangle and white edge on front, spine and back, praise from The Globe and Mail, Calgary Herald and others. DJ and book, both As New.
